Abstract
The embodiment of the invention provides the methods and relevant device of a kind of determining suspicion user, and the unconspicuous suspicion user of feature in platform is broadcast live for identification.This method comprises: obtaining the direct broadcasting room of target user's concern in live streaming platform;Calculate the similarity in the direct broadcasting room of target user's concern between any two direct broadcasting room;The synchronism index of target user and the normality index of the target user described in the similarity calculation of any two direct broadcasting room in direct broadcasting room based on target user concern;Judge the target user synchronism index and the target user normality index whether and meanwhile meet preset condition;If so, determining that the target user is suspicion user, the suspicion user is the user of brush popularity in the live streaming platform.

Background technique
With the progress of network communication technology and the speed-raising of broadband network, net cast technology has obtained more and more hairs
Exhibition and application.
On live streaming platform, false brush concern behavior, such brush concern row are frequently present of in order to reach certain purposes
For strong influence can be caused to the live streaming ecology of platform.It would therefore be desirable to have some effective methods can identify that those have brush
The user of concern suspicion.
The method that the generally recognized abnormal brush hangs concern behavior be using some strong rules, these rules be by it is some more
What apparent exception was identified.Some risk subscribers can be identified using the method for strong rule, however in order to avoid manslaughtering
Can be by the very strict of rule setting, therefore those cheating users with obvious characteristic are only able to find, therefore other can be omitted
The unconspicuous suspicion user of feature.

101, the direct broadcasting room of target user's concern in live streaming platform is obtained.
In the present embodiment, the direct broadcasting room of user's concern in the available live streaming platform of the device of suspicion user, the mesh are determined
Mark user be broadcast live platform in it is to be determined whether be suspicion user user, suspicion user be broadcast live platform in brush popularity use
Family.Specifically, determining that the device of suspicion user can establish the bigraph (bipartite graph) in live streaming platform between user and direct broadcasting room, at two
In figure, a part is the vertex formed by the user in direct broadcasting room, and another part is then the vertex formed by direct broadcasting room.If with
There is concern behavior at family to direct broadcasting room, then can form a line between the user and the direct broadcasting room on the diagram.The bigraph (bipartite graph) is
One digraph is directed toward live streaming intermediate node by user node.It can be by identifying the institute connecting in bigraph (bipartite graph) with target user
There is fixed point, obtains the direct broadcasting room of target user's concern.
102, the similarity in the direct broadcasting room of target user's concern between any two direct broadcasting room is calculated.
In the present embodiment, determine the device of suspicion user after the direct broadcasting room for getting target user's concern, Ke Yiji
The similarity in the direct broadcasting room of target user's concern between any two direct broadcasting room is calculated, specific as follows:
The concern index of the direct broadcasting room of target user's concern is obtained, such as can be calculated by concern flowing water, the concern
The indexs such as the current concern number of index such as direct broadcasting room, nearly 1 day newly-increased attention number;
It is calculated in the direct broadcasting room of target user's concern between any two direct broadcasting room based on concern index by following formula
Similarity:
Sim (u, v)=1 (u ∈ g, v ∈ g);
(u ∈ g, the v ∈ g of sim (u, v)=00,g≠g0);
Wherein, g is a net region in grid set G, g0It is different from the net region g in grid set G
Net region, grid set G is that each feature in concern feature is cut into predetermined number and is obtained, and u is that target user is closed
Any one direct broadcasting room in the direct broadcasting room of note, v are any one direct broadcasting room in the direct broadcasting room of target user's concern.Namely
It says, for several concern indexs of the direct broadcasting room of target user's concern, it is assumed that the quantity of the concern index is k.These are paid close attention to
Index regards the feature space of k dimension as, carries out uniform cutting to the feature of every dimension, if the number of segment of cutting is n,
Entire k dimensional feature space will be divided into a grid, and the set of the grid is denoted as G, then each direct broadcasting room can fall in certain of grid
A net region g, net region g are a grid in grid set G, after having grid dividing, target user i concern
The similarity sim (u, v) of direct broadcasting room u and direct broadcasting room v can be calculated by following following formula:
Sim (u, v)=1 (u ∈ g, v ∈ g);
(u ∈ g, the v ∈ g of sim (u, v)=00,g≠g0);
When direct broadcasting room u and direct broadcasting room v belong to identical net region, then the similarity of direct broadcasting room u and direct broadcasting room v are 1,
It otherwise is 0.

105, determine that target user is suspicion user.
In the present embodiment, when the synchronism index of the target user and the normality index of target user meet in advance simultaneously
If when condition, determining that the device of suspicion user can determine that the target user is suspicion user, namely people is brushed in live streaming platform
The user of gas.
It should be noted that determining that the device of suspicion user can also traverse each of live streaming platform through the above steps
User, to determine all suspicion users in live streaming platform;Due to being aware of the suspicion user of all brush popularities in live streaming platform,
The bigraph (bipartite graph) then constructed by step 101 can be determined each in live streaming platform based on all suspicion users in live streaming platform
The ratio for the suspicion user for including in direct broadcasting room;Later, determine that target direct broadcasting room is suspicion direct broadcasting room, target direct broadcasting room is live streaming
The ratio of suspicion user is greater than the direct broadcasting room of preset threshold in platform.As long as that is, the user paid close attention in some direct broadcasting room
Ratio for suspicion user reaches preset threshold, so that it may determine that the direct broadcasting room is suspicion direct broadcasting room, that is, be related to brushing people
The direct broadcasting room of gas, the preset threshold, such as can be 60%.
